Indexation de plusieurs indicateurs dans une formule

  • Rversion finale: Zurich
  • Mis à jour 31 juil. 2025
  • 3 minutes de lecture
  • Vous pouvez écrire une formule pour mesurer l’écart par rapport à la cible globale de plusieurs indicateurs combinés. Un tel indicateur de formule est appelé « indicateur d’index ».

    Les performances des processus, services, groupes et autres entités business sont souvent suivies et surveillées à l’aide de plusieurs indicateurs. Lors de l’affichage et de l’analyse des performances de ces processus, services d’entreprise ou groupes de travail, la vue d’ensemble peut être confuse et ambiguë. Par exemple :
    • Bien que les scores de trois indicateurs se soient quelque peu améliorés, les scores de 2 d’entre eux sont toujours inférieurs à la cible et 1 est supérieur à la cible.
    • Le score d’un indicateur est resté plus ou moins le même et est toujours inférieur à la cible.
    • Le score d’un indicateur s’est considérablement détérioré, mais il est heureusement juste au-dessus de la cible.
    En examinant ces informations, les réponses aux questions suivantes ne sont pas claires :
    • Les performances globales du processus/service/groupe sont-elles toujours au niveau souhaité ou au-dessus ?
    • Les performances globales se sont-elles améliorées ?

    Un indicateur d’index peut répondre à ces questions. Avec un indicateur d’index, les scores de plusieurs indicateurs sont agrégés en un seul score. Il s’agit d’une moyenne pondérée de plusieurs indicateurs. Si la somme pondérée de ces indicateurs s’améliore, le score calculé de la formule d’indice augmente. Comme tout autre indicateur, l’indicateur d’index indique si le score est bon ou non et s’il s’est amélioré ou non.

    Le principe d’un indicateur d’index est de calculer une valeur de score indexée à 100 pour chaque indicateur. Lorsque vous disposez de ces scores indexés, vous êtes mathématiquement autorisé à calculer une moyenne globale de ceux-ci.

    Pour être inclus dans un indicateur d’index, un indicateur doit avoir une direction et une cible. La formule de base pour calculer le score indexé pour un indicateur qui a une direction Maximiser est la suivante :
    100 + (((actual score - target) / target) * 100)
    Pour les indicateurs qui ont une direction Minimiser , la formule est la suivante :
    100 - (((actual score - target) / target) * 100)

    Si vous pondérez les indicateurs de manière uniforme, vous pouvez indexer l’agrégation finale sur 100 au lieu d’indexer les indicateurs individuels sur 100.

    Vous pouvez utiliser les méthodes de l’API PAFormulaUtils() pour obtenir l’écart entre le score et la cible de l’indicateur à partir Centre d'analyse du . Pour plus d’informations, consultez Obtenir les méthodes d’analyse dans les formules:
    pa.getGap(indicator, On date) / pa.getGlobalTarget(indicator, On date)

    En raison de l’opérateur différent pour la direction différente, si le score d’un indicateur sous-jacent s’améliore (à la hausse ou à la baisse), le score de l’indicateur d’indice augmente. Par conséquent, définissez toujours la direction de l’indicateur d’index sur Maximiser.

    Si aucune valeur cible n’est définie pour un indicateur, utilisez plutôt une valeur norme. Les indicateurs dont la valeur cible ou la valeur de la norme est égale à 0 ne peuvent pas être utilisés dans l’indicateur d’index, car il faudrait diviser par 0.

    Définissez une cible de 100 pour chaque indicateur d’indice. Cette cible est le score global calculé indexé si tous les indicateurs sous-jacents ont un score réel égal à leur valeur cible ou normale.

    Un indicateur d’indice mesure l’écart par rapport à la cible globale de plusieurs indicateurs combinés. Il mesure le « pourcentage de réalisation de l’objectif ».

    Indicateur d’index utilisant les méthodes PAFormulaUtils()

    Dans l’exemple suivant, vous souhaitez un index unique qui agrège l’écart entre le score et la cible globale pour les indicateurs suivants :
    • Pourcentage d’incidents en retard.
    • Âge moyen de la dernière mise à jour des incidents ouverts.
    • Nombre total d’incidents ouverts.
    Pour obtenir cet index unique, procédez comme suit pour produire un indicateur d’index :
    1. Vous accédez à Analyse des performances > Indicateurs de formule et cliquez sur Nouveau. Les indicateurs d’index sont un cas d’utilisation des indicateurs de formule.
    2. Vous donnez à l’indicateur un nom significatif, tel que Écart d’incident agrégé.
    3. Comme vous créez un indicateur d’index, vous définissez la direction sur Maximiser.
    4. Dans le champ Formule , vous utilisez les fonctions Parcourir pour une méthode et Parcourir pour un indicateur pour créer la formule suivante :
      var a = pa.getGap($[[% of open overdue incidents]], score_start) / pa.getGlobalTarget($[[% of open overdue incidents]],score_start);
      var b = pa.getGap($[[Average age of last update of open incidents]], score_start) / pa.getGlobalTarget($[[Average age of last update of open incidents]], score_start);
      var c = pa.getGap($[[Number of open incidents]], score_start) / pa.getGlobalTarget($[[Number of open incidents]], score_start);
      var res = 100 - (100 * (a + b + c) / 3);
      res;
      Les trois indicateurs sont pondérés de manière égale, de sorte que l’agrégation est indexée à 100 au lieu des indicateurs individuels.